Which is not a disease that can affect an older adult's eyesight?
 
  a. Glaucoma
  b. Presbyopia
  c. Cataract
  d. Macular degeneration

Answer to Question 1

B

Feedback
A Incorrect. Glaucoma, a disease marked by increased pressure within the eye that potentially leads to optic nerve damage, is the most common cause of blindness after age 65
B Correct. Presbyopia, a gradual decline in the flexibility of the lens, makes close-up focusing more difficult and is a common age-related change, but not a disease.
C Incorrect. A cataract is a disease marked by clouding and blurring of the lens.
D Incorrect. Macular degeneration is a disease characterized by damage to the central part of the retina that leaves the outer edges of the visual field intact.

Answer to Question 2

C
As OA progresses, the joint deteriorates and can become unstable, thereby increasing the risk of falls. The joint stability will not improve without physical therapy or surgery; therefore the patient needs to report instability to the health care provider. Although ibuprofen is much less likely to cause dizziness, hypotension, or sedation, nonsteroidal antiinflammatory agents such as ibuprofen are poor analgesic choices for older adults; they can aggravate hypertension and impair renal blood flow. The nurse avoids recommending increased rest because rest contributes to stiffness. Stretching is an important form of exercise for older adults with OA; it helps maintain joint flexibility and range of motion.

Giardia is one of the most common intestinal parasites worldwide, and infects up to 20% of the world population, mostly in poorer countries with inadequate sanitation. Infections are most common in children, though chronic Giardia is more common in adults.

Ether was used widely for surgeries but became less popular because of its flammability and its tendency to cause vomiting. In England, it was quickly replaced by chloroform, but this agent caused many deaths and lost popularity.
